随着移动互联网的普及和人们生活节奏的加快,传统的到店洗车方式逐渐暴露出其不便之处。越来越多的车主希望有一种更加便捷、高效的洗车服务。因此,开发一款预约洗车上门洗车小程序,构建一个洗车上门的O2O平台,成为了满足这一市场需求的佳解决方案。本文将探讨如何通过微信小程序实现这一目标,并详细介绍其核心功能设计、技术实现与架构设计、安全性与性能优化等内容。
一、市场背景与需求分析在当今社会,汽车已经成为许多家庭和个人的重要交通工具。然而,繁忙的工作和快节奏的生活使得许多人难以抽出时间去洗车店进行车辆清洁。特别是在大城市中,交通拥堵和停车难的问题更加剧了这一困境。因此,提供一种能够上门服务的洗车解决方案显得尤为重要。通过微信小程序开发预约洗车上门服务,不仅可以节省用户的时间,还能提高洗车效率,为用户提供更好的体验。
二、核心功能设计用户注册与登录
支持微信一键登录,简化注册流程,提高用户体验。
用户信息管理,包括联系方式、地址等基本信息的维护。
预约洗车
用户可以选择合适的时间和地点进行洗车预约。
提供多种洗车套餐选择,如基础洗车、深度清洁、打蜡抛光等。
实时查看可预约的时间段,避免冲突。
订单管理
用户可以查看历史订单记录,包括已完成和未完成的订单。
支持订单状态跟踪,及时了解洗车进度。
提供评价系统,用户可以对服务质量进行反馈。
支付功能
集成第三方支付接口(如微信支付),方便用户在线支付费用。
支持优惠券和积分抵扣,增加用户粘性。
智能调度
根据用户的预约信息和地理位置,自动匹配近的洗车师傅。
实时更新洗车师傅的位置,确保准时到达。
通知提醒
预约成功后发送短信或微信消息提醒用户。
洗车前再次确认时间和地点,减少沟通成本。
客服支持
提供在线客服功能,解答用户疑问,处理投诉建议。
设置常见问题解答模块,提高自助服务能力。
三、技术实现与架构设计为了确保小程序稳定运行且易于维护扩展,建议采用以下技术栈:
前端:微信小程序框架(WeChat Mini Program)
后端:Node.js + Express
数据库:MySQL或MongoDB
云服务商:阿里云或腾讯云提供服务器托管及存储服务
地图API:高德地图或百度地图用于实现位置服务
消息推送:使用极光推送或其他第三方服务实现通知提醒功能
整个系统的架构采用微服务架构思想,将不同功能模块拆分为独立的服务单元,以提高灵活性和维护性。同时,利用消息队列(如RabbitMQ)来处理异步任务,保证高并发下的服务质量。
四、安全性与性能优化HTTPS加密:全站启用SSL证书,确保数据传输过程中的安全性。
权限控制:对不同类型的操作员分配相应级别的访问权限,防止越权行为发生。
备份恢复:定期备份重要数据文件,并建立灾难恢复计划以应对突发状况。
缓存机制:利用Redis缓存热点内容减少数据库查询次数,加快页面加载速度。
负载均衡:使用Nginx等负载均衡器分散请求压力,提高系统稳定性。
数据库优化:合理设计索引,避免全表扫描;定期清理无用数据,保持数据库整洁。
五、总结通过开发一款预约洗车上门洗车小程序,不仅可以极大地方便车主获取洗车服务,还能有效提升洗车行业的服务水平和效率。未来我们将继续关注新技术发展趋势,不断迭代更新产品功能,为广大用户提供更加优质的服务体验。希望这款小程序能够成为连接车主与洗车师傅之间的桥梁,让洗车变得更加轻松愉快。
- 休闲旅游景区展示景点讲解在线购票小程序定制 2025-01-10
- 租赁小程序开发电脑租赁汽车出租场地厂房租赁平台发布开发 2025-01-10
- 智慧园区系统开发企业环保小程序环境监测污染物数据处理APP 2025-01-10
- 同城配送小程序开发送菜送水小程序成品配送系统开发源码 2025-01-10
- 家政服务app开发生活维修保洁派单上门预约软件小程序定制 2025-01-10
- 短剧小程序开发抖音分销付费软件海外微短剧系统定制 2025-01-10
- 礼品礼盒大闸蟹线上提货卡微信小程序开发APP公众号定制 2025-01-10
- 智能家居小程序开发物联网设备远程监控模块对接数据大屏幕系统 2025-01-10
- 人力资源管理软件招聘求职小程序薪酬绩效企业招工考勤打卡开发 2025-01-10
- 旅游出行微信小程序定制团建攻略旅行社导游在线预约开发 2025-01-10